Story summary
- General Muhoozi Kainerugaba confirmed Uganda will compete in the Invictus Games Birmingham 2027.
- Sir Clive Alderton said the King approved Uganda’s participation and urged the chief of defence forces to resume preparations.
- Rob Owen, CEO of the Invictus Games Foundation, welcomed Uganda as the 26th nation joining the event.
- A royal source said Uganda’s entry ends the dispute over the palace letter concerning Harry and Meghan’s non-working status.
